    Advance Auto Parts, Inc. is a leading automotive aftermarket parts provider that serves both professional installers and do-it-yourself customers. Advance operates 4,500+ stores and distribution centers in the United States, Puerto Rico, and the U.S. Virgin Islands. The Company also serves independently owned CarQuest branded stores across these locations in addition to Mexico and various Caribbean Islands.
